Transaction 70669d18344481d91e3cc2be18f1ad41ec8179a4dcdb76f31d645b934fc89c3c

2 Input
2 Outputs
  • 70669d18344481d91e3cc2be18f1ad41ec8179a4dcdb76f31d645b934fc89c3c:0
  • value  515045
    address  bc1qgd562j4vumnfd7xkrc2thyfn0ruf09g4jydkfm
  • 70669d18344481d91e3cc2be18f1ad41ec8179a4dcdb76f31d645b934fc89c3c:1
  • value  25925000
    address  3AX8SES1FQB1peUTQNKz3YqESxTNBLDZgK